浮动路由是什么?
浮动路由(Floating Route)是一种网络路由策略,其主要作用是在网络故障或路由器故障时提供备选路径。在网络中,每个设备通常具有多条路由路径,其中一些路径是主路径,而其他路径则是备选路径。当主路径不可用时,备选路径就可以用来转发数据,以保证网络的连通性。
浮动路由的应用场景
浮动路由主要应用于需要高可用性和容错能力的网络中,例如企业级网络、数据中心、云计算等。在这些场景下,网络故障或路由器故障可能会导致数据丢失或网络不可用,从而影响业务的正常运行。浮动路由可以避免这种情况的发生。
浮动路由的工作原理
浮动路由的工作原理是,当主路径不可用时,备选路径会被激活。备选路径通常与主路径具有相同或相似的路径属性,但其路由度量值会比主路径更大,以便在主路径恢复后,备选路径可以自动撤销。备选路径的路由度量值还必须小于其他可能路径的度量值,以确保其成为最优路径。
实现浮动路由需要网络设备支持相关协议,例如虚拟路由器冗余协议(VRRP)和热备份路由协议(HSRP),它们可以提供冗余的网关地址,同时通过检测主网关的可用性,自动切换到备份网关。
浮动路由的优点
1. 提高可用性和容错能力:当主路径不可用时,备选路径可以自动接管,从而保证了网络的连通性和服务的可用性。
2. 提高网络效率:通过选择最优路径,浮动路由可以减少网络传输延迟和拥堵,提高网络效率。
3. 简化网络管理:浮动路由可以自动检测主路径的可用性,并在必要时切换到备选路径,从而减少了网络管理员的操作和维护成本。
浮动路由的缺点
1. 需要设备的支持:实现浮动路由需要网络设备支持相关协议,设备的选型和配置可能会增加成本。
2. 可能会影响路由收敛速度:当主路径重新可用时,设备需要重新计算路由表,可能会导致路由收敛速度变慢,从而影响网络性能和可用性。
浮动路由是一种重要的网络路由策略,可以提高网络的容错能力和可用性,同时简化网络管理。在实际应用中,需要根据网络规模、业务要求和设备支持情况等因素进行选择,并合理配置和管理,以确保其有效性和安全性。
网友留言(0)